Preparation: The Foundation of Clean Audio
Most location sound problems can be avoided with thorough preparation. Rushing into a shoot without scouting and testing your setup almost guarantees audio issues that are nearly impossible to fix later. Here’s how to set yourself up for success.
Scout the Location
Visit the filming location before the shoot day. Walk through each space where actors will speak and note potential noise sources: HVAC systems, refrigerators, street traffic, nearby construction, echoing hallways, or even chirping birds. Use your ears and a portable recorder to capture a sample of the ambient noise at different times of day. This gives you a baseline of the environment’s sound profile and helps you plan mitigation strategies.
During scouting, also consider the room’s acoustics. Hard surfaces like tile, glass, and bare walls create reverb that can muddy dialogue. Soft furnishings, curtains, and carpets absorb sound. If the location is too live, you might need to bring sound blankets or other acoustic treatments.
Select the Right Microphone and Recorder
Choosing the right microphone for your scene is critical. The three most common types for location sound are:
- Shotgun microphones: Hypercardioid or supercardioid pattern. Excellent for rejecting off-axis noise. Ideal for boom-mounted use when the mic can be placed close to the actor but out of frame. Brands like Sennheiser (MKH 416) and Rode (NTG5) are industry standards. Learn more about the MKH 416.
- Lavalier (lav) microphones: Tiny omnidirectional or cardioid mics that clip onto clothing. Best for capturing dialogue up close, especially in noisy environments or wide shots where the boom can’t reach. Popular models include the DPA 6060 and Rode Lavalier II. Explore DPA’s 6060 series.
- Boundary (PZM) microphones: Used for capturing room tone or ambient sound in a fixed position. Less common for dialogue but useful for certain scenes.
Your recorder should offer at least two XLR inputs with professional preamps, support 48V phantom power, and record at 24-bit/48kHz (minimum). Reliable field recorders include the Sound Devices MixPre series, Zoom F-series, or the Tascam DR-70D. Always carry extra batteries and storage media.
Assemble Your Sound Kit
Beyond microphones and recorders, a complete location sound kit includes:
- Boom pole: A lightweight, extendable pole (carbon fiber or aluminum) that allows the boom operator to hold the shotgun mic close to the source.
- Blower or windscreen: Essential for outdoor shoots. A furry windjammer (dead cat) can cut wind noise dramatically. Indoors, a simple foam windscreen may suffice.
- Shock mount: Isolates the mic from handling vibrations transmitted through the pole.
- Headphones: Closed-back, circumaural headphones for accurate monitoring. The Sony MDR-7506 is a classic choice. Test them before every shoot.
- Slate: A clapperboard is not just for picture sync – it also gives a distinct transient that helps the sound editor align audio and video.
- Sound blankets and C-stands: To dampen reverb or block unwanted ambient noise on set.
Test Everything Before the First Take
Set up your gear on location, run cables, power on all devices. Check that phantom power is active where needed, that recorders are set to the correct file format (WAV is preferred over MP3), and that all tracks are being recorded. Record a few seconds of silence to capture room tone. Then, have an actor (or a stand-in) speak a few lines while you monitor levels on headphones. Adjust the gain so that the loudest peaks hover around -12 dB to -6 dB. Avoid hitting 0 dB – digital clipping sounds harsh and is unrecoverable.
If you encounter hums or buzzes, troubleshoot ground loops or try moving power cables away from audio cables. A portable power conditioner can help in locations with dirty power.
On-Set Techniques for Clean Location Sound
During filming, the sound team (often just a boom operator and a mixer/recordist) must remain focused. Good habits and communication with the director and camera crew make all the difference.
Boom Microphone Technique
The goal is to position the shotgun mic as close to the actor’s mouth as possible without entering the frame. For a typical over-the-shoulder shot, this means the boom operator stands above the actor and aims the mic down at a 45-degree angle toward the mouth. For two-shots, the boom may need to swing between speakers or use two boom mics for separate actors.
Key points for boom operators:
- Keep the mic pointing directly at the sound source (the actor’s mouth). Even a few degrees off-axis reduces high-frequency clarity.
- Anticipate movement: if an actor turns their head, follow the angle smoothly.
- Watch for shadows: use a black or white ping-pong ball on the mic to diffuse shadows if needed, or coordinate with the gaffer.
- Hold the boom pole with relaxed arms to avoid fatigue and reduce handling noise.
Outdoors, even a slight breeze can ruin a take. A high-quality blimp and windjammer are mandatory. Indoors, be careful of reflections: the mic should not point toward a hard wall or ceiling, as that will pick up reflected sound and create phasing.
Lavalier Microphone Placement
Lavs offer intimacy and consistency, especially when actors move around or in wide shots. But poor placement can cause rustling, muffled sound, or clothing noise. Follow these guidelines:
- Position the lav about 6-8 inches below the mouth, typically on the sternum or collarbone.
- Hide the mic under clothing using a sticky mount or a small loop. For outdoor shoots, a gentle fabric over the mic can reduce wind noise.
- To minimize clothing rustle, tape the cable down to the actor’s body using medical tape (e.g., Hypafix or Micropore). Route the cable around the collar or under the shirt.
- For actors with chest hair or who wear loose clothing, use a “RyCote” type mount or a small foam cover to decouple from fabric.
- Always record safety audio: using both boom and lav, you can later choose the cleaner track in post.
Work with the Director and Crew
The sound mixer should coordinate with the director of photography (DP) before every shot. If the DP plans a move that knocks the boom out of position, you need a moment to adjust. Call “Speed” when the recorder is rolling and ready, and wait for the “action” cue. After a take, the boom operator can note any audio issues (mic shadow, rustling, airplane noise) and request a retake if necessary.
Communication also means respecting cues for quiet on set. The sound team can help by using hand signals or a quiet radio channel. When the camera assistant calls “Roll sound,” everyone stops moving and talking until the director says “Cut.”
Capture Room Tone
At the beginning of each scene (or whenever the location changes), record at least 30 seconds of the natural ambient sound – called room tone. The actors and crew stay perfectly still and silent. This track is essential for later editing: it allows the sound designer to fill gaps in dialogue, smooth out edits, and match backgrounds when ADR is used. Without clean room tone, dialogue edits become jarring.
Deal with Problematic Environments
Sometimes the location is simply noisy – a busy street, a crowded café, a set next to an AC unit. Workarounds include:
- Using wireless transmitters and placing lavs extremely close to actors.
- Turning off noisy appliances (or asking the location manager for permission).
- Recording wild lines (audio recorded separately after the take) outdoors, then replacing the section in post.
- Draping sound blankets over noise sources like generators or cameras.
- Shooting at quieter times of day (e.g., early morning for street scenes).
If all else fails, plan for ADR (Automated Dialogue Replacement) during post-production. But ADR is time-consuming and rarely matches the natural performance, so it’s best to get clean audio on set.
Advanced Tips for Professional Location Sound
Beyond the basics, seasoned location sound recordists use a few more techniques to ensure pristine audio.
Using Timecode and Wireless Systems
For multi-camera shoots or when using separate recorders, timecode synchronization is indispensable. Tentacle Sync or Denecke boxes can jam sync the audio recorder and cameras, meaning the editor can automatically align clips in post without a slate. This saves hours of manual syncing.
Wireless microphone systems (like the Shure Axient, Sennheiser EW series, or Lectrosonics) offer freedom of movement but introduce risks of interference and dropouts. Always scan for the cleanest frequency before shooting and keep the transmitter within line-of-sight if possible. Use diversity receivers for better reliability.
Monitoring with a Sound Cart
A sound cart allows the mixer to see waveforms, check levels, apply limiters, and route audio to multiple destinations (camera, boom operator’s headphone feed, etc.). Even a compact bag-based system with a MixPre or Zoom F8n can give you valuable visual feedback. The graph of recorded levels helps you catch clipping, distortion, or suddenly low levels before the take ends.
Always record a safety track at a lower gain level (e.g., -12 dB lower) using a second track if your recorder supports it. This can save you if the main track clips unexpectedly.
Handling Extreme Dynamic Range
Scenes with quiet dialogue followed by a loud explosion or door slam require careful gain staging. Use the recorder’s limiter (or a hardware compressor like the Sound Devices CL-1) to smooth out peaks without audible artifacts. In post, you can compress or expand the dynamic range, but a well-recorded track with conservative gain gives the editor the most flexibility.
Post-Production: Polishing the Location Track
Once the footage is in the editing suite, the sound post-production team (dialogue editor, sound designer, re-recording mixer) cleans up and enhances what was captured on set. The better the location sound, the less work they have to do – and the better the final result.
Dialogue Editing
Dialogue editing involves removing lip smacks, breaths that are too loud (though natural breaths are often kept to maintain realism), clicks, and pops. The editor uses spectral analysis tools (like iZotope RX) to isolate and fix unwanted sounds. Room tone is used to fill gaps between words and match the background across different takes. If the boom and lav tracks have different tonal qualities, the editor can blend them or choose the one that works best per line.
If any dialogue is unusable due to noise, ADR is recorded in a studio. The actor watches the scene and re-speaks their lines while the editor aligns the new recording with the lip movements. Modern ADR uses pitch correction and reverb to blend with production sound.
Noise Reduction and Restoration
Even the best location sound may have some background hum, hiss, or low rumble. Tools like iZotope RX’s spectral denoiser, noise gate, and de-hummer can clean up the track without making it sound artificial. The key is to apply noise reduction subtly; aggressive processing causes a “swishing” or “watery” artifact that is worse than a low level of noise.

Mixing and Balancing
The final mix blends dialogue, sound effects, ambisonics (or room tone), and music. Dialogue should sit clearly in the center, with effects and music spread around it. Use equalization to cut low frequencies (below 80 Hz) that can cause muddiness, and boost around 3–5 kHz for clarity. Reverb is used sparingly – a small room is simulated with a short decay, a large hall with a longer one – but overuse washes out the dialogue.
Most films aim for a broadcast standard of -24 LUFS (loudness units) with a true peak of -2 dB. Your audio can be mixed at that level, but the sound editor should deliver a full dynamic range version as well for cinema release.
Backup and Organization
Never rely on a single storage medium. During production, sound files should be backed up to at least two separate hard drives at the end of each shooting day. Use clear naming conventions: project name, scene, take, etc. A consistent folder structure saves time in post. Many recordists use a multimedia report sheet (like from Sound Devices or a simple spreadsheet) to log takes and notes.
Common Mistakes and How to Avoid Them
Even experienced sound recordists can slip up. Here’s a checklist of pitfalls and their fixes:
- Distortion: Always lower the gain rather than risk clipping. Use the recorder’s limiter as a safety net.
- Wind noise: Invest in a quality blimp and windjammer. If you hear wind, move to a sheltered spot or wait for a lull.
- Plosives (P-pops): Use a pop filter on the boom or position the mic slightly angled to the side.
- Handling noise: Use a shock mount and cradle the boom pole softly. Avoid touching the cable.
- Clothing rustle on lavs: Use proper mounting and tape the cable. Consider using a Rycote Undercover or similar mount.
- Inconsistent levels: Monitor constantly and ride the gain when actors change volume, but do it smoothly.
- Forgetting to press record: Develop a routine: call “Speed” only after you confirm recording. Check the waveform is moving.
Tools of the Trade: A Recommended Minimalist Kit
If you are building a location sound kit from scratch, consider this starter setup:
- Boom: Rode NTG5 or Sennheiser MKH 416
- Boom pole: K-tek or Ambient (carbon fiber, 12 ft)
- Wind protection: Cinela or Rycote blimp with furry cover
- Shock mount: Rycote Invision
- Lavs: DPA 6060 (two) or Sennheiser MKE 1
- Wireless transmitters: Sennheiser EW 100 G4 or Shure QLX-D
- Recorder: Sound Devices MixPre-6 II or Zoom F8n
- Headphones: Sony MDR-7506 (for mixing) or Audio-Technica ATH-M50x (for monitoring)
- Slate: Denecke TS-3 or a digital timecode slate
